Margaret Qualley Joins Death Stranding Cast After Bizarre Perfume Ad Dance
Hideo Kojima has revealed that he cast Margaret Qualley for the role of Mama in Death Stranding after being captivated by her performance in a Spike Jonze fragrance advertisement for Kenzo. Sharing the viral commercial on Twitter on April 25, Kojima tweeted, "I saw this and offered her the role of Mama (Lockne) in Death Stranding."
The advertisement features Qualley executing a dynamic and unusual dance routine to a bass-heavy track, reminiscent of the iconic Fat Boy Slim video "Weapon of Choice," which starred Christopher Walken. Qualley's performance includes shaking, grimacing, and even firing lasers from her fingers, showcasing a unique choreography that caught Kojima's eye.
In Death Stranding, Qualley portrays Mama, also known as Målingen, a brilliant scientist working for Bridges in the United Cities of America. Alongside her twin sister Lockne, whom she also plays, Mama co-developed the Chiral Network, a crucial communication system that enables instant data transfer across the game's world.

Fans have reacted enthusiastically to Kojima's casting revelation. One fan praised him, saying, "You are a visionary, Kojima-san," while another humorously commented, "I do this most mornings, Kojima-san. Hire me too."
Currently, Hideo Kojima is busy with multiple projects. Death Stranding 2 is set to release on June 26, 2025. Additionally, he's working on a live-action Death Stranding film in collaboration with A24, and an Xbox-published game titled OD, which he describes as "a game I have always wanted to make." Kojima is also developing a PlayStation exclusive action espionage project.
